Tip: You don’t need xanthan gum for protein ice cream- just try to use a more equal ratio of almond milk to frozen fruit. This will create an ice cream sorbet-type delight 🙂

ice cream (2)

In the mix:

-1 C-ish frozen organic blueberries

-1 C-ish of almond milk

-1 scoop of each type of protein

-3/4 t decaf espresso powder

-cinnamon

-crumbled amazeball
